The Deadly Confrontation: Tom’s Final Stand

The saga’s tragic end unfolded around 2:30 a.m. on September 8 when police responded to a ram-raid at a PGG Wrightson farm supply store in Piopio, Waikato. CCTV captured Tom and his eldest daughter, masked and on a quad bike, smashing into the shop. As officers laid spikes on Waipuna Road, Tom’s ATV hit them, stopping the escape. When the first officer approached, Tom allegedly fired a high-powered rifle at close range, striking him in the head and shoulder—critically injuring the “highly respected” cop, who underwent emergency surgery at Waikato Hospital.
A second officer arrived seconds later and returned fire, killing Tom at the scene. Police Commissioner Andrew Coster was blunt: “There was no doubt Tom Phillips wanted to kill… He had no regard for the safety of those children.” The injured officer, now stable but with an eye injury, shared “a couple of laughs” with visiting officials, but his recovery will be long. Tom’s eldest daughter, present during the shootout, was taken into custody and provided “crucial” info to locate her siblings, warning police of at least one firearm—confirmed by a stash of guns and ammo found nearby.
Inside the Jungle Camp: A Survivalist Nightmare
Police released eerie photos of the campsite on September 9, revealing a rudimentary hideout 2km from the shooting site, obscured by ferns and material. Quad bikes formed shelters, with scattered fizzy drinks, tires, and basic supplies hinting at a mobile, nomadic life. “Whilst what you see… might suggest they’ve been there for some time, over the last four years, Mr. Phillips and his children have been very mobile,” said Acting Deputy Commissioner Jill Rogers.
The “very remote” site, surrounded by dense vegetation, included tents, an ATV, and evidence of scavenging—possibly stolen stock from farms, as police urged checks for missing livestock. Despite 1,358 days without formal education or medical care, the children were found “healthy under the circumstances,” undergoing checks for trauma. Oranga Tamariki (NZ’s child welfare agency) has custody, prioritizing their well-being amid a High Court injunction shielding details.
